Projects

foxp

Playground | Source

Type-safe validation library for eliminating runtime errors

Reject invalid states (e.g., division by zero, invalid email patterns, layout conflicts) before execution.

const div = foxp.bi.div() // Use builtin provided by foxp.
div(foxp.putPrim(3), foxp.putPrim(2)).value //=> 3/2
// @ts-expect-error: Enforce non-zero divisor at compile-time.
div(foxp.putPrim(3), foxp.putPrim(0)).value
const invalid_email = foxp.putPrim('invalid-url')
// @ts-expect-error: Reject invalid url at compile-time.
foxp.tid<pre.IsEmail>()(invalid_email)

cion

Playground | Source

Type-level Lisp interpreter - fully developed at the type level.

const test_in_doc_a1: Cion.Lisp<`(/ 2 3)`> = '2/3'
// @ts-expect-error: Type '"0"' is not assignable to type '"nil"'.
const test_in_doc_a2_err: Cion.Lisp<`(/ 2 0)`> = '0'

About this site

Leveraging cion and foxp to prevent unintended UI layout collisions.
This replaces manual inspection with automated, type-safe guarantees.

Core Principles:

  • Code-First: All article snippets are validated.
  • Compile-Time Safety: Eliminating critical UI errors before runtime.
  • Minimalist Architecture: Markdown-based content delivered via SSG.

Pipeline: Code-driven content -> Markdown (mdx) -> Type check (TypeScript/cion/foxp) -> UI (React/GSAP/Zustand) -> SSG (Vite)
